Lamisil Cream is used to treat fungal infections of the skin including the following tinea infections:• Athlete’s foot - between the toes• Jock itch - groin and inner thigh area• Ringworm - commonly affects arms, legs, trunk or neck• Moccasin-type tinea - sole of the footLamisil Cream can also be used to treat skin infections caused by Candida, a type of yeast.

-Apply Lamisil Cream once daily. You should apply Lamisil Cream only to the skin on the outside of the body.1. Clean and dry the affected area.2. Apply a thin layer of Lamisil Cream to the affected skin and surrounding area.3. Rub in gently.4. Wash your hands after touching the infected skin so that you do not spread the infection.
For external use only. Pharmacy medicine. Keep out of reach of children.
Always read the label and follow the directions for use.
Do not use:- On children under 12 years.- If you are breastfeeding. - If tube seal is broken or missing. Consult your doctor or pharmacist before using this product if you are pregnant or may become pregnant. Contains benzyl alcohol as a preservative. Also contains cetyl alcohol and stearyl alcohol which may cause local skin reactions.
Terbinafine Hydrochloride 10mg/g, sorbitan monostearate, cetyl palmitate, cetyl alcohol, stearyl alcohol, polysorbate 60, isopropyl myristate, sodium hydroxide, purified water, benzyl alcohol.
